随着人工智能技术的快速发展,多模态智能体(Multimodal Intelligent Agent)逐渐成为研究和应用的热点。多模态智能体是一种能够同时处理和理解多种模态数据(如文本、图像、语音、视频、传感器数据等)的智能系统,能够在复杂环境中完成感知、推理、决策和执行任务。本文将从架构设计和实现技术两个方面,深入探讨多模态智能体的核心要素及其应用价值。
一、多模态智能体的架构设计
多模态智能体的架构设计是实现其功能的基础,通常可以分为以下几个层次:
1. 感知层(Perception Layer)
感知层负责从多种模态数据中提取信息。常见的模态包括:
- 文本(Text):如自然语言文本、文档等。
- 图像(Image):如RGB图像、深度图像等。
- 语音(Speech):如语音信号、音频数据等。
- 视频(Video):如动态视频流。
- 传感器数据(Sensor Data):如温度、湿度、加速度等。
感知层的关键技术包括:
- 计算机视觉(Computer Vision):用于图像和视频的特征提取和理解。
- 自然语言处理(NLP):用于文本的理解和生成。
- 语音处理(Speech Processing):用于语音识别和合成。
2. 认知层(Cognition Layer)
认知层负责对多模态数据进行融合和理解,形成对环境的综合认知。这一层的核心任务包括:
- 知识表示(Knowledge Representation):将多模态数据转化为结构化的知识表示。
- 跨模态理解(Cross-Modal Understanding):理解不同模态之间的关联和语义一致性。
- 推理与学习(Reasoning and Learning):基于知识和经验进行推理和学习。
认知层的关键技术包括:
- 知识图谱(Knowledge Graph):用于表示和管理多模态数据之间的关系。
- 深度学习(Deep Learning):用于跨模态特征的对齐和融合。
- 图神经网络(Graph Neural Network, GNN):用于处理图结构的知识表示和推理。
3. 决策层(Decision Layer)
决策层负责根据认知层的理解结果,制定行动策略。这一层的关键任务包括:
- 目标设定(Goal Setting):明确智能体的目标和任务。
- 决策推理(Decision Reasoning):基于当前状态和目标,选择最优行动方案。
- 风险评估(Risk Assessment):评估决策的潜在风险和不确定性。
决策层的关键技术包括:
- 强化学习(Reinforcement Learning):用于动态环境中的决策优化。
- 博弈论(Game Theory):用于多智能体之间的协作与竞争。
- 不确定性建模(Uncertainty Modeling):用于处理决策中的不确定性。
4. 执行层(Execution Layer)
执行层负责将决策层的策略转化为具体的行动。这一层的关键任务包括:
- 动作规划(Action Planning):制定具体的执行步骤。
- 行为控制(Behavior Control):控制智能体的物理或虚拟行为。
- 反馈机制(Feedback Mechanism):根据执行结果调整策略。
执行层的关键技术包括:
- 机器人控制(Robot Control):用于物理机器人或虚拟代理的控制。
- 人机交互(Human-Machine Interaction):用于与人类用户的交互。
- 实时反馈(Real-Time Feedback):用于动态调整执行策略。
二、多模态智能体的实现技术
多模态智能体的实现涉及多种技术的融合与协同。以下是实现多模态智能体的关键技术:
1. 多模态数据融合技术
多模态数据融合技术是实现多模态智能体的核心技术之一。常见的融合方法包括:
- 特征级融合(Feature-Level Fusion):在特征层面进行融合,如将图像特征和文本特征进行对齐。
- 决策级融合(Decision-Level Fusion):在决策层面进行融合,如将不同模态的分类结果进行投票。
- 混合融合(Hybrid Fusion):结合特征级和决策级的融合方法。
2. 跨模态学习技术
跨模态学习技术旨在理解不同模态之间的语义关联。常见的跨模态学习方法包括:
- 对齐学习(Alignment Learning):通过学习模态间的对齐关系,实现跨模态理解。
- 对比学习(Contrastive Learning):通过对比不同模态的特征,增强跨模态关联。
- 生成对抗网络(GANs):用于生成跨模态数据,如将文本生成图像。
3. 实时计算与优化技术
多模态智能体需要在动态环境中实时运行,因此需要高效的计算和优化技术:
- 边缘计算(Edge Computing):将计算能力部署在边缘设备,减少延迟。
- 分布式计算(Distributed Computing):通过分布式系统实现大规模数据的并行处理。
- 模型压缩与优化(Model Compression and Optimization):通过模型剪枝、量化等技术,降低计算资源消耗。
4. 人机协作与交互技术
人机协作与交互技术是多模态智能体的重要组成部分,包括:
- 自然语言交互(Natural Language Interaction):通过对话系统实现与用户的自然交互。
- 多模态交互(Multimodal Interaction):结合文本、语音、图像等多种模态进行交互。
- 情感计算(Affective Computing):理解并模拟人类情感,提升交互体验。
三、多模态智能体的应用场景
多模态智能体在多个领域具有广泛的应用潜力,以下是几个典型场景:
1. 智能制造
在智能制造中,多模态智能体可以用于设备监控、故障诊断和生产优化。例如,通过结合传感器数据、图像数据和文本数据,实现对设备状态的实时监控和预测性维护。
2. 智慧城市
在智慧城市中,多模态智能体可以用于交通管理、环境监测和公共安全。例如,通过结合视频数据、传感器数据和社交媒体数据,实现对城市交通流量的实时预测和优化。
3. 医疗健康
在医疗健康领域,多模态智能体可以用于疾病诊断、治疗方案制定和患者监护。例如,通过结合医学图像、基因数据和病历数据,实现对疾病的精准诊断和个性化治疗。
4. 教育与培训
在教育与培训领域,多模态智能体可以用于个性化学习、虚拟教学和技能评估。例如,通过结合语音数据、图像数据和学习行为数据,实现对学习者的个性化指导和评估。
四、多模态智能体的未来发展趋势
多模态智能体的发展将朝着以下几个方向推进:
1. 技术融合与协同
未来的多模态智能体将更加注重多种技术的融合与协同,如深度学习、强化学习、知识图谱和图神经网络等。
2. 人机协作与共情
未来的多模态智能体将更加注重与人类的协作与共情,通过情感计算和自然语言交互,提升人机交互的体验。
3. 伦理与安全
随着多模态智能体的应用范围不断扩大,伦理与安全问题将受到更多关注。例如,如何确保智能体的决策透明性、可解释性和公平性。
五、申请试用
如果您对多模态智能体的技术和应用感兴趣,可以申请试用相关产品或服务,以体验其实际效果。申请试用即可获取更多信息。
多模态智能体作为人工智能领域的前沿技术,正在逐步改变我们的生活方式和工作方式。通过合理的架构设计和实现技术,多模态智能体将在更多领域发挥其潜力,为人类社会带来更大的价值。
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。